4.3L 262

The 4.3L 262 engine represents a specific displacement and cylinder configuration commonly found in marine inboard applications. These engines are designed for reliable and efficient power delivery, suitable for a wide range of recreational and light commercial vessels. Their robust construction and balanced performance make them a popular choice for powering boats such as runabouts, cruisers, and ski boats, providing the necessary torque for acceleration and sustained operation on the water.

This service repair manual covers Mercury MerCruiser Marine Engine #18 GM V-6 262 CID (4.3L) models, including Gen + Engines, manufactured between 1993 and 1997. These V-6 engines, with a displacement of 262 cubic inches or 4.3 liters, are known for their robust engineering and reliability in marine applications. They feature a bore of 4.00 inches and a stroke of 3.48 inches, and were available with various fuel delivery systems including carburetors and electronic fuel injection. Specific models covered include a range of Alpha and Bravo drive configurations, such as MCM 4.3L Alpha, MCM 4.3LX Gen+ Bravo, and MCM 262 Magnum EFI Gen+ Bravo, among others.

This service repair manual covers Mercury Mercruiser 262 CID (4.3L) Balance Shaft engines manufactured between 1993 and 1997. These GM V6 engines feature a 262 cubic inch displacement and are equipped with a balance shaft for smoother operation. Models covered include various Alpha and Bravo drive systems, such as the MCM 4.3L Alpha, MCM 4.3LX Alpha, MCM 4.3LX Gen+ Alpha, MCM 4.3LXH Gen+ Alpha, MCM 4.3LX Bravo, MCM 4.3LX Gen+ Bravo, MCM 4.3LXH Gen+ Bravo, MCM 262 Magnum EFI Gen+ Bravo, and MCM 262 Magnum EFI Gen + Alpha. The engines utilize either a 2-barrel MerCarb or 4-barrel Weber carburetor, or throttle body electronic fuel injection. Cooling systems are designed for seawater or closed cooling applications, and the engines meet BSO/SAV emission standards.
